SATURDAY
We depart London at 08:00 and make our way to Stonehenge. Here you can view the ancient stones. We will arrive at Stonehenge before the bulk of the tourist traffic, allowing for a great view of the stones.
Heading away we travel on to Glastonbury the unofficial New Age Capital of England. The Abbey is believed to be the first Christian structure in Britain and legendary burial place of King Arthur and Lady Guinevere. The nearby Tor is believed to guard the entrance to the Underworld! Our last stop for the day is at Wells. The Cathedral here is one of the most beautiful Medieval buildings making Wells one of the smallest cities in England. Don't forget to visit the medieval Vicar's Close. Then it is on to our hotel for the night.
SUNDAY
After breakfast we travel to Cheddar Gorge. We will travel through the steep limestone gorge. You can visit the famous Cheddar Show caves and take a spectacular trip underground. Don't forget Cheddar is home to the famous Cheddar Cheese.
On to Bristol where we will visit 2 examples of the great engineer Isambard Kingdom Brunel. First the Clifton Suspension Bridge 245 foot high spanning the River Avon. The second is SS Great Britain. First launched in 1843 as the first ever iron passenger liner that operated between England and Australia.
